## [0.1.20] - 2026-03-08
### Changed
- Refactored the embedded web UI in the API server to be loaded from a separate `index.html` file instead of a large inline string, improving maintainability.
## [0.1.19] - 2026-03-08
### Added
- Added `POST /unpair` endpoint and "Unpair Device" button in the web UI to remove a Bluetooth device from the host's paired devices.
## [0.1.18] - 2026-03-08
### Added
- Added `POST /pair` endpoint and "Pair Device" button in the web UI to easily pair/trust the printer via `bluetoothctl` for Classic Bluetooth connections.
## [0.1.17] - 2026-03-08
### Added
- Added automatic fallback to BLE connection if Classic Bluetooth (RFCOMM) fails with `[Errno 12] Out of memory`, a common issue on Linux with stale device states.
## [0.1.16] - 2026-03-08
### Fixed
- Corrected typos in the Code128B bit pattern table for characters '$' (ASCII 36) and ')' (ASCII 41), which caused incorrect barcodes to be generated.

## Troubleshooting
### Classic Bluetooth: [Errno 12] Out of memory
If you encounter `[Errno 12] Out of memory` failures on Classic Bluetooth connections, it typically implies a stale state in the BlueZ stack or the printer's radio. As of v0.1.17, the library automatically falls back to a BLE connection when this specific error occurs.
If you wish to resolve the underlying Classic Bluetooth issue, these steps can help:
- **Power cycle the printer**: This clears the printer's radio state and is often the only fix if the device is rejecting RFCOMM.
- **Verify Pairing**: Classic Bluetooth (RFCOMM) requires the device to be paired and trusted in the OS. You can use the "Pair Device" or "Unpair Device" buttons in the Home Assistant add-on's web UI, or run `bluetoothctl pair <MAC>` and `bluetoothctl trust <MAC>` (or `bluetoothctl remove <MAC>`) on the host. Pairing is not required for BLE.
- **Restart Bluetooth**: `systemctl restart bluetooth` on the host can clear stuck socket handles.
